Transaction 3c84b2cb58eefa71e47f90636104c24c2d56d1bd116599f7e430ae52a25ba779
1 Input
1 Output
-
3c84b2cb58eefa71e47f90636104c24c2d56d1bd116599f7e430ae52a25ba779:0
- value
- 500714
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b7bc7d9264ea2253302e7d2258ead50768f230c OP_EQUAL
- address
- 34CLT9tMKzgNvkMN5GehfEKEAZkQEWSmz3